Advantages and Features of Magnetic Whiteboards
The writing surface of a magnetic whiteboard is a specialized material made of steel coated with baked enamel. It is designed for use with dedicated whiteboard markers, allowing for easy erasure-much like writing with chalk on a blackboard. The core consists of several layers of rigid corrugated cardboard.
Magnetic whiteboards possess specific characteristics regarding their panels, corners, accessories, and durability.
The writing surface often utilizes materials such as tempered glass, offering high strength and scratch resistance. Corners may be fitted with ABS engineering plastic protectors, while accessories often include aluminum alloy frames and steel back panels that provide moisture and corrosion resistance, resulting in a long service life.
